What is a Home Loan Balance Transfer?
A home
loan balance transfer allows borrowers to transfer their existing home loan
from one lender to another. This can be advantageous if the new lender offers a
lower interest rate or better terms, helping borrowers save money on EMIs
(Equated Monthly Installments) or reduce their overall loan tenure.
Benefits of Home Loan Balance Transfer
- Lower Interest Rates: Transferring to a lender
with a more competitive rate can significantly reduce the financial
burden.
- Improved Loan Terms: Borrowers may find better
terms, such as reduced processing fees or flexible repayment options.
- Enhanced Customer Service: A lender with a strong
reputation for customer service can make the loan experience smoother.
What is a Top-Up Loan?
A top-up
loan is an additional loan amount that can be availed on an existing home loan.
This allows homeowners to borrow extra funds for various purposes—such as home
renovations, medical expenses, or educational needs—while benefiting from the
favorable terms of their primary loan.
Benefits of Top-Up Loans
- Lower Interest Rates: Top-up loans typically
have lower interest rates compared to personal loans or credit cards.
- Flexible Usage: The funds can be used for
any purpose, offering financial flexibility.
- Simplified Documentation: Since the borrower is
already a customer, the documentation process is usually simpler.
Combining Balance Transfer with Top-Up
For many
borrowers, combining a home loan balance transfer with a top-up loan presents a
compelling financial strategy. This dual approach allows them to:
- Reduce Overall Debt Burden: By transferring to a lower
interest rate while also securing additional funds at a favorable rate.
- Consolidate Finances: Streamline multiple
financial obligations into one manageable loan.
- Access Extra Funds: Address immediate
financial needs without the stress of high-interest debt.

Eligibility Criteria for Home Loan Balance Transfer with Top-Up in India
When
considering a home loan balance transfer with a top-up, lenders typically have
specific eligibility criteria. While these can vary between financial
institutions, here are the common factors that borrowers should keep in mind:
1. Existing Home Loan Requirements
- Current Loan Amount: A minimum outstanding
balance on the existing home loan may be required.
- Repayment Track Record: A strong repayment history
(usually 12 months of timely payments) is often essential.
2. Income Criteria
- Stable Income Source: Borrowers should have a
stable and sufficient income, which can be from salary, business, or other
sources.
- Income Documentation: Lenders typically require
salary slips, bank statements, or income tax returns to verify income.
3. Credit Score
- Minimum Credit Score: A good credit score
(generally above 750) is crucial for eligibility, as it reflects the
borrower’s creditworthiness.
- Credit History: A positive credit history,
with no major defaults, will strengthen the application.
4. Age and Employment
- Age Limit: Borrowers are usually
required to be between 21 to 65 years old.
- Employment Status: Stable employment (either
salaried or self-employed) is necessary, with a minimum number of years in
the current job or business.
5. Property Details
- Property Ownership: The property should be in
the borrower’s name, and it must be fully constructed (not under
construction).
- Property Valuation: Lenders may require a
valuation of the property to determine the maximum loan amount.
6. Loan Amount
- Top-Up Amount: The additional loan amount
may depend on the borrower’s repayment capacity and the value of the
property.
- Total Loan to Value (LTV)
Ratio:
Lenders may have a maximum LTV ratio that includes the existing loan and
the top-up.
7. Documentation
- KYC Documents: Valid identity and address
proof (like Aadhar card, passport, etc.).
- Property Documents: Title deeds, encumbrance
certificate, and other relevant documents related to the property.
